Bicycle Helmets Recalled by UVEX Sports
Dear uvex Customer,
Thank you for your patience on this Uvex helmet recall.
This recall involves seven models of UVEX helmets. The helmets come in a variety of colors with different colored chin straps. The helmets have a model number inside the helmet under the fitting pad on the top right side. The affected helmet model numbers are XB017, XB022, XB025, XB027, XB032, XB036 and XB038 (see attachment “UVEX Recall notice info”).
Consumers should stop using the helmets and contact UVEX for a free compliant helmet or a refund of the purchase price.
Customers should go to the UPS link below to obtain a shipping label and Return Authorization number.
https://row.ups.com/Default.aspx?Com...sword=testuser
If you are requesting a replacement, please see the attached catalog and indicate in the comments area a 1st and 2nd choice. Don’t forget your size as well. If you indicate that you want a replacement helmet, but do not specify which one, UVEX will choose a replacement helmet for you. If there is no replacement available, a refund will be issued.
All refunds and replacements will be processed on a timely basis.
For any further questions regarding your return please call 1-978-702-4260 or email customerserviceusa@uvexsports.com

Uvex Recall helmet MSR price
XB017
Supersonic $110.00
XB022
Onyx $110.00
City 7 $110.00
XB025
XP $99.00
XP 100 $99.00
XP City $99.00
City 9 $99.00
XB027
Sport Boss $110.00
Boss Race $110.00
XB032
FP 3 $190.00
Race3 $190.00
XB036
Race 5 $239.00
XB038
Ultrasonic $139.00
* If you have a recipet that shows a higher retail price we will honor it.
